Understanding the Basics of Frequency Drives
Frequency drives, also known as variable frequency drives (VFDs), are innovative electronic devices widely used in various industries today. With the ability to control the speed of electrical motors, frequency drives have revolutionized the way numerous applications operate. In this article, we will explore the fundamental concepts of frequency drives and how they can benefit businesses across different sectors.
Exploring Diverse Applications of Frequency Drives
From manufacturing plants to HVAC systems, frequency drives find applications in a wide range of industries. These advanced drives enable precise control over motor speed, allowing businesses to optimize their operations, reduce energy consumption, and increase overall efficiency. Whether it is in pumps, fans, conveyors, or process equipment, frequency drives have become an indispensable technology that offers enhanced control and performance.
The Advantages of Implementing Frequency Drives
When integrated into processes, frequency drives offer numerous benefits. Let's explore some of the key advantages businesses can gain by implementing these advanced devices:
1. Energy Efficiency: Frequency drives allow motors to run at optimal speed, reducing energy waste and lowering operational costs. Motors operating at reduced speeds consume less power, resulting in significant energy savings.
2. Improved Process Control: By precisely adjusting motor speed, frequency drives enable businesses to maintain optimal process conditions. This level of control ensures better product quality, increased productivity, and enhanced overall efficiency.
3. Increased Equipment Lifespan: Frequency drives help reduce wear and tear on motors by minimizing sudden starts and stops. This, in turn, extends the lifespan of equipment, reducing maintenance and replacement costs.
4. Enhanced Safety: With the ability to regulate motor speed, frequency drives provide an extra layer of safety by preventing unexpected motor overloads. By monitoring and adjusting motor performance, these drives ensure safe and stable operation, preventing potential accidents.
5. Environmental Sustainability: The energy-saving characteristics of frequency drives contribute to reducing carbon footprint, making them an eco-friendly choice for businesses seeking sustainability and complying with environmental regulations.

Factors to Consider when Selecting a VFD Frequency Drive
1. Power and Voltage Requirements:
One of the first steps in choosing the right VFD frequency drive is determining the power and voltage requirements of your equipment. Consider the horsepower (HP) and voltage rating of the motors you wish to control. Ensure that the VFD frequency drive you select is compatible with these specifications to avoid potential damage or inefficiency in operation.
2. Load Characteristics:
Understanding the load characteristics is crucial as it directly affects the type and size of the VFD frequency drive needed. Determine whether your application demands constant torque, variable torque, or constant horsepower. This information will help you identify the appropriate VFD model, ensuring optimal performance and energy efficiency for your specific load.
3. Integrated Safety Features:
Safety is paramount in any workplace. When choosing a VFD frequency drive, prioritize those with integrated safety features such as short-circuit protection, overvoltage protection, ground fault protection, or thermal overload protection. These features safeguard the system from faults, reduce downtime, and prevent potential hazards.
Exploring the Advantages and Limitations of VFD Frequency Drives
VFD frequency drives offer numerous advantages for various applications. Let's take a closer look at some of the benefits and limitations:
1. Energy Efficiency:
One of the most significant advantages of using VFD frequency drives is the potential for energy savings. By adjusting motor speed to match the load requirements, VFDs can reduce energy consumption by up to 50%. This energy efficiency not only helps lower operational costs but also minimizes environmental impact.
2. Enhanced Process Control:
VFD frequency drives allow for precise control of motor speed and torque, providing smoother operation and improved process control. This level of control leads to increased productivity, reduced wear and tear on machinery, and enhanced product quality.
3. Harmonic Distortion and Filtering:
A limitation of VFD frequency drives is the generation of harmonics, which can impact other equipment within the electrical system. However, VFD manufacturers often include built-in harmonic filtering mechanisms to mitigate these disturbances. When selecting a VFD frequency drive, consider the available harmonic mitigation options to ensure compatibility with your existing electrical infrastructure.

Various Applications of FD100M Frequency Drives
FD100M frequency drives find applications in a wide range of industries, including manufacturing, HVAC (Heating, Ventilation, and Air Conditioning), wastewater treatment, and more. In manufacturing, these drives can regulate the speed of conveyor belts, pumps, and fans, thereby improving efficiency and reducing energy consumption. In the HVAC sector, FD100M frequency drives enable precise control of air handler unit fans and compressor motors, resulting in energy savings and enhanced comfort. Additionally, FD100M drives are instrumental in wastewater treatment, where they control the speed of pumps, aerators, and mixers, contributing to efficient processes and cost savings.
